Indiana Academy of Science: Welch Biodiversity Fellowship: January 22
This award is intended to support biodiversity research (e.g., surveys and systematics) of plants and their allies (e.g., algae and fungi). One award of $400.00 will be made each year.

Enhancing Peer Review: Use New Resources to Prepare for Upcoming Application Changes
To align the structure and content of applications with review criteria, and shorten the length of applications, NIH will soon implement a shortened and restructured application format for submissions for FY2011 funding.
